Publication | Closed Access
FPGA implementation of ICA algorithm for blind signal separation and adaptive noise canceling
65
Citations
13
References
2003
Year
Source SeparationEngineeringIca AlgorithmSpeech EnhancementNoise ReductionSpeech RecognitionChip DesignNoiseIndependent Component AnalysisAdaptive Noise CancelingHealth SciencesAdaptive FilterComputer EngineeringMulti-channel ProcessingSignal ProcessingBlind Signal SeparationSpeech SeparationSpeech ProcessingSignal Separation
An field programmable gate array (FPGA) implementation of independent component analysis (ICA) algorithm is reported for blind signal separation (BSS) and adaptive noise canceling (ANC) in real time. In order to provide enormous computing power for ICA-based algorithms with multipath reverberation, a special digital processor is designed and implemented in FPGA. The chip design fully utilizes modular concept and several chips may be put together for complex applications with a large number of noise sources. Experimental results with a fabricated test board are reported for ANC only, BSS only, and simultaneous ANC/BSS, which demonstrates successful speech enhancement in real environments in real time.
| Year | Citations | |
|---|---|---|
Page 1
Page 1